Driving from Eugene: What to Know

Eugene sits in Oregon, in the Pacific Northwest, and most trips out of town start on the local highway network before joining the interstate system. Fill up before you leave — fuel is usually cheaper in town than at highway service plazas — and check conditions before longer drives, since weather in the Pacific Northwest can change travel times considerably. The main corridor for trips listed on this page is I-5, so check for construction or closures on that route before setting out.
